WebOct 1, 2009 · Her CMV IgM and PCR were positive and subsequent liver biopsy confi rmed CMV hepatitis. She was discharged with plans for outpatient labs and clinic appointment. LFTs were done every week aft er discharge, which showed persistent elevation of liver enzymes. At that time, patient was treated with valganciclovir for three weeks. The liver function tests typically include alanine … WebMay 27, 2024 · CMV is the most common infectious cause of birth defects in the United States. About 1 out of 200 babies is born with congenital CMV. One out of 5 babies with congenital CMV will have symptoms or long-term health problems, such as hearing loss. In the most severe cases, CMV can cause pregnancy loss.

WebThe standard laboratory test for diagnosing congenital CMV infection is polymerase chain reaction (PCR) on saliva, with urine usually collected and tested for confirmation. The reason for the confirmatory test on urine is that most CMV seropositive mothers shed CMV in their breast milk. This can cause a false-positive CMV result on saliva ...
